Popular Elements of Vintage Pink Christmas
Vintage pink Christmas decor is all about capturing the essence of yesteryears, with a modern twist. Here are some popular elements to help you achieve this enchanting look:

- Color Palette: Stick to soft, muted pink shades reminiscent of vintage candy hues. Pair them with complementary colors like dusty blue, mint green, or warm gold to create a harmonious color scheme.
- Vintage Ornaments: Incorporate vintage-inspired ornaments such as glass balls, wooden shapes, and felt figures. Look for pieces with a soft, worn finish to enhance the vintage aesthetic.
- Retro Lighting: Opt for warm, Edison-style bulbs or vintage-inspired string lights to create a cozy, inviting atmosphere. Colored bulbs in your chosen pink shades can add an extra touch of whimsy.
- Nostalgic Decor: Include vintage-inspired decor like old-fashioned toys, antique books, and retro wrapping paper to evoke a sense of nostalgia.
- Natural Elements: Incorporate natural materials like pine cones, dried flowers, and evergreen branches to add texture and depth to your decor. This also helps to ground the look and prevent it from feeling too saccharine.
Creating a Vintage Pink Christmas Tablescape
A vintage pink Christmas tablescape is the perfect way to bring this enchanting theme to life. Here's a simple guide to help you create a stunning, Instagram-worthy tablescape:

| Layer | Ideas |
|---|---|
| Tablecloth | Use a soft, muted pink tablecloth or runner as the base for your tablescape. You can also opt for a vintage-inspired lace or embroidered cloth in a complementary color. |
| Centerpiece | Create a whimsical centerpiece using a mix of vintage-inspired elements. Consider a collection of glass bottles filled with candy-colored flowers, vintage ornaments, or even a vintage-style toy train. |
| Place Settings | Set the table with vintage-inspired dishware in your chosen pink shades. Mix and match patterns for a more eclectic look. Top each place setting with a vintage-style napkin and a unique, personalized name tag. |
| Lighting | Add warmth and ambiance to your tablescape with vintage-inspired lighting. Consider using colored bulbs in your pink shades or even vintage-style lanterns filled with fairy lights. |
